-How to optimize your gear-


Step 1 - First, you need to drop an item with the right stats for your build. (RNG)

(If you are lucky and drop an item with GA’s, you need to be lucky AGAIN to have the right stats on it.)


Step 2 - Tempering. (RNG)

If you got a good item with the right stats, you need luck to get the right tempering stats on your item.
And the worst part here: If you fail (due to the limitation of 6 try’s) you can salvage the item and need to start all over again. (When tempering items with GA’s, this problem is even worse.)
So this takes you back to step no. 1.

But let’s say you get the right stats from tempering…
Then, you can go to the next step


Step 3 - Enchanting. (RNG)

Here you have unlimited try’s but the stat pool of many items is still too big.
Yes, you can always try to reroll but the more times you reroll, the more gold and angelbreath (rare material, mostly available from helltides) you waste.

So, if you’re out of gold/angelbreath - you need to go back to farm whispers/helltides.
But let’s say you are lucky (again) and get to the next step…


Step 4 - Masterworking (RNG)

Here you need to run pits for masterworking materials.
Every 4th upgrade, you get a RANDOM 25% bonus.
To get the most out of it, you need to hit certain stats.
If you dont hit the certain stats, you need to reset it all with a big amount of gold. (5 million gold for 1 reset… now think about that in most cases you need to reset it multiple times to hit the right stat.)

So if you’re out of gold (again, like in step no. 4) and/or out of pit materials, you need to go back to whispers/pits.
If you’re lucky and hit the right stats with masterworking:
…Congratulations! You just finished your first item!

…Now, go do the same for all other items!

1- Yes. There is too much RNG.

2- Some of the RNG fatigue could be mitigated if they got rid of (or vastly evened out) the “weighted” chances.

Affixes like skill boosts are obviously MUCH rarer than other affixes, and Tempering has also been pretty much proven, through testing, to have weighted chances… with the more sought after tempers having a lower chance.

It’s one thing to deal with a ton of RNG when it’s actually RANDOM (with somewhat equal chances), it’s another thing entierly to deal with tons of RNG that is intentionally skewed against the stats you want.
